Monday, February 9, 2026
Teesdale Mercury

Teesdale Mercury

Page 252 of 425 1 251 252 253 425
ADVERTISEMENT

Stay connected

ADVERTISEMENT

Most popular

ADVERTISEMENT
ADVERTISEMENT